us_main.book.book Page 22 Tuesday, April 6, 2021 1:44 PM 22 OPERATION-WASHER Cycle Modifiers About Modifier Buttons Each cycle has default settings that are selected automatically. You can also customize these settings using the cycle modifier buttons. • Repeatedly press the button for the desired modifier until the indicator light for the desired setting is lit. • The washer automatically adjusts the water level for the type and size of wash load for best results and maximum efficiency. • This is a high-efficiency washer, and the water levels may be much lower than you expect. This is normal, and cleaning/rinsing performance will not be compromised. NOTE • The LED next to the setting lights up when the setting is selected. • To protect your garments, not every wash temperature, spin speed, soil level, or option is available with every cycle. • A chime will sound twice and the LED will not light if the desired setting is not allowed for the selected cycle. • Follow the fabric care labels on the garment for best results. Temp. Make sure the wash temperature is suitable for the type of load you are washing. • Press the Temp. button repeatedly to select the wash and rinse temperature combination for the selected cycle. • All rinses use unheated cold water. • Cold rinses use less energy. The actual cold rinse temperature depends on the temperature of the cold water at the faucet. Spin Higher spin speeds extract more water from clothes, reducing drying time and saving energy. • Press the Spin button repeatedly until the desired speed is selected. • Some fabrics, such as delicates, require a slower spin speed. Soil Adjusting the soil level setting will modify the cycle times and/or wash actions. • Press the Soil button repeatedly until the desired soil level is selected. • The Heavy soil setting may increase cycle times. The Light soil setting may decrease cycle times. Options and Extra Functions Your washer includes several additional cycle options to customize cycles to meet your individual needs. • Select the desired option after selecting the desired cycle and settings. NOTE • The LED for the option will light when the option is selected. • To protect your garments, not every option is available with every cycle. • A chime will sound twice and the LED will not light if the selected option is not allowed for the selected cycle. Special Cycles Sanitary This cycle washes clothes at a high temperature. Tub Clean This is a special cycle designed to clean the inside of the washer. Steam Adding this option to a wash cycle helps provide superior cleaning performance. Using steam gives fabrics the cleaning benefits of a very hot wash. • Steam may not be clearly visible during steam cycles. This is normal. Too much steam could damage clothing. • Do not use steam with delicate fabrics such as wool and silk, or easily discolored fabrics. WARNING • Do not touch the door during steam cycles.
